Position Summary:

We are seeking a hands-on Plant Manager to lead day-to-day plant operations for GrayWolf Modular’s modular data center manufacturing business. This role is accountable for safety, quality, delivery, labor productivity, material flow, and operating discipline across a high-mix industrial facility producing large engineered assemblies. The Plant Manager will create the management operating system that keeps production predictable while supporting rapid growth in modular power, cooling, and infrastructure output.

Core Responsibilities:

• Lead daily plant operations with accountability for safety, quality, delivery, throughput, labor productivity, and shipment readiness.

• Coordinate production, warehouse, quality, testing, production control, and operations project management so work flows predictably through the factory.

• Establish a disciplined plant operating system with tier meetings, KPI boards, floor presence, escalation paths, and clear action ownership.

• Partner with engineering and project management on release timing, execution sequencing, capacity, and issue resolution.

• Drive labor planning, staffing, supervision, training, and performance management for a multi-discipline manufacturing workforce.

• Improve plant layout, material flow, work-center discipline, standard work, and visual management.

• Support safe receiving, kitting, point-of-use material strategy, finished-goods staging, and shipping readiness.

• Partner with quality and testing to reduce rework, close issues quickly, and improve overall output predictability.

• Scale plant output without losing operating discipline, plant-floor accountability, or safety focus.

What We Do

Founded in 1978 under the legacy banner Horn Industrial, GrayWolf is a multi-discipline, self-performing contractor with three divisions: Industrial Construction, Structural Steel, and Modular. We deliver complex projects with safety, speed, and certainty across industrial and commercial markets. We provide single source, vertically-integrated construction services including preconstruction support, civil, sitework, fabrication, MEP, piping, equipment installation, manufacturing of complex assemblies and modular products, and more for heavy industrial and commercial markets.
